Bayern Munich is preparing for a transformative summer, with significant personnel changes on the horizon. The club has concentrated its recent efforts on securing contract extensions for key players such as Alphonso Davies, Jamal Musiala, and Joshua Kimmich. However, behind the scenes, there are plans to address defensive gaps, particularly following Eric Dier's confirmed transfer to AS Monaco and the possibility of selling Kim Min-jae. With a need for center backs and a right back, names like Jonathan Tah and Sacha Boey are in consideration. The future of Konrad Laimer, with a contract until 2027, appears stable as speculation intensifies.
